The Importance of Long-Term Software Support

Long-term software support ensures that rugged watches remain functional and secure years after their initial release. As technology evolves, manufacturers need to provide updates that fix bugs, patch security vulnerabilities, and improve device performance. Without ongoing support, users risk using outdated software that may compromise their data or limit device capabilities.

Challenges in Providing Software Updates for Rugged Watches

Developing and maintaining software for rugged watches presents unique challenges:

  • Limited hardware resources, such as processing power and storage, restrict the complexity of updates.
  • Harsh environmental conditions can affect hardware longevity, making hardware updates more difficult.
  • Ensuring compatibility with a variety of mobile devices and operating systems adds complexity.
  • Balancing software updates with battery life preservation is essential for user satisfaction.

Strategies for Effective Long-Term Support

Manufacturers employ several strategies to provide effective long-term software support:

  • Regular firmware updates that address security and performance issues.
  • Utilizing modular software architectures that allow easier updates and feature additions.
  • Providing clear communication channels for users to receive update notifications and support.
  • Implementing backward compatibility to ensure new updates work with older hardware models.
